Transaction a20231e768c441a51e324f3b8b621d8b13ee1f2414fa3d6341eeda591c6d4260

100 Input
1 Outputs
  • a20231e768c441a51e324f3b8b621d8b13ee1f2414fa3d6341eeda591c6d4260:0
  • value  73094088
    address  31xd781HRsEVpLJqrGPTuRfn2RufSRJC14